Job Description

Role Overview: You will be leading the end-to-end process of managing whistleblower complaints, ensuring timely, fair, and confidential investigations. Your role is critical to upholding the Company's integrity, ethical standards, and compliance with global whistleblower protection laws. Key Responsibilities: - Governance & Oversight: - Co-ordinate with Whistleblower Investigation Committee (WBIC) and Principal Director Governance to ensure adherence to the company's global whistleblower policy. - Collaborate with the Chief Ombudsperson, CHRO, Legal Counsel, and Audit teams to ensure robust governance. - Case Management: - Receive, acknowledge, and triage whistleblower complaints. - Oversee delegation of investigations to internal teams or external agencies. - Ensure interim updates to relevant stakeholders (e.g., CFO, Legal, HR) as per policy. - Investigations: - Conduct or supervise independent, unbiased investigations into allegations of misconduct, fraud, harassment, or ethical violations. - Review evidence including financial records, emails, chats, and interview transcripts. - Draft detailed investigation reports and recommend appropriate actions. - Compliance & Risk Mitigation: - Ensure compliance with applicable laws such as the Whistleblower Protection Act, Sarbanes-Oxley, and internal codes of conduct. - Recommend preventive measures and anti-fraud controls in various processes covered in the Whistleblower investigations. - Stakeholder Engagement: - Liaise with HR Compliances and teams to ensure a coordinated response and resolution. - Provide strategic insights to senior leadership on trends and systemic risks. - Training & Awareness: - Develop training programs and awareness campaigns on whistleblower rights and reporting mechanisms. - Promote a culture of transparency and ethical conduct. Qualifications: - Bachelor's or master's degree in Law Finance, Compliance, or a related field. - Certifications such as ACFE (Certified Fraud Examiner) or Forensic Investigation credentials are preferred. - Strong understanding of global whistleblower laws and data privacy practices. - Excellent analytical, communication, and interrogation skills.
